What is a Half-Hourly Electricity Meter?
What are half hourly electricity prices in the UK? These costs can range from £300 to £600 annually, separate from electricity tariff costs. Half hourly meter suppliers are that type of business electricity meter used in the UK that tracks how much electricity your business uses every 30 minutes. It then sends that information directly and securely to your energy supplier — no manual readings required.
This frequent and accurate data capture means you’re billed for exact usage, removing the risks of estimated invoices or billing errors.
Half-hourly business electricity meters are mandatory for organisations that consume 100 kW or more during any 30-minute period, but smaller businesses can also choose to install them voluntarily for better energy tracking and billing accuracy.
How does a Half-Hourly Meter Work?
Instead of taking manual meter readings or relying on estimates, an HH meter is connected to both a data logger and a secure communications device. Your electricity consumption data is automatically transmitted every 30 minutes through an encrypted network to your supplier.
Here’s what that means for your business:
- No manual readings required
- No estimated bills
- Near real-time business energy usage tracking
This kind of commercial energy monitoring provides full transparency over how and when your business uses power — allowing for tailored business electricity tariffs UK that better match your actual usage profile.
Do you need a Half-Hourly Meter?
Half hourly meter installation process : If your business uses 100 kW or more of electricity during any half-hour period, then by law, under the UK’s electricity settlement rules (Profile Classes 05–08), you're required to have one installed.
However, even if you're not legally obliged, industries like:
- Manufacturing
- Supermarkets
- Data Centres
- Hotels and Hospitality
...often choose smart meters for businesses in the UK from Ofgem to gain better insight into their energy performance and unlock savings.

Are there any downsides?
While beneficial, there are a few things to be aware of:
- Data Overload – Without the right tools, the volume of usage data can feel overwhelming.
- Contract Commitment – This type of meters usually are based on fixed term contracts with their supplier.
- Installation Costs – Although usually minimal, some installations may involve setup charges.
